  • Patent number: 9936769
    Abstract: Footwear element including a flexible outer sole assembly and a flexible upper, the footwear element extending lengthwise from a rear end to a front end, widthwise between a lateral portion and a medial portion, and height-wise from an outer surface of the outer sole assembly to an upper end, the footwear element having a shoe insertion opening. The footwear element includes spikes projecting from the area of the outer surface of the outer sole assembly. The footwear element includes at least one reinforcement, the reinforcement including a base and a wall, the base extending opposite the outer sole assembly outside of the footwear element, the wall extending from the base toward the upper end, also outside of the footwear element.

  • Publication number: 20160366985
    Abstract: A footwear element includes a sole assembly extending along an extension direction between opposite front and rear ends; a flexible upper includes a lower portion adjoining the sole assembly and configured to receive a shoe of a user, and an upper portion extending from the lower portion away from the sole assembly; and a fastening element configured to cooperate with a locking mechanism provided on the apparatus for reversibly retaining the footwear element on the apparatus. The fastening element is removably mounted on the footwear element.

  • Publication number: 20160213101
    Abstract: A footwear element including a flexible outer sole assembly and a flexible upper, both of which demarcate a fitting volume, the footwear element extending lengthwise from a rear end to a front end, widthwise between a lateral portion and a medial portion, and height-wise from an outer surface of the outer sole assembly to an upper end, the footwear element having a shoe insertion opening. The footwear element includes spikes projecting from the area of the outer surface of the outer sole assembly. The footwear element includes a removable reinforcement having the general appearance of a plate, the reinforcement extending lengthwise from a rear end to a front end, widthwise between a lateral side and a medial side, and depth-wise between a support surface and a receiving surface, the reinforcement being arranged opposite the outer sole assembly, and the reinforcement being substantially non-deformable in longitudinal flexion, along a transverse axis.
